Abstract

Theassignment problem is one part of a linear program which generallyincludes n tasks that must be assigned to m workers, each of whom hasdifferent competencies in carrying out tasks. The Hungarian method isone method that can be used to solve this problem. The purpose of thisstudy is to optimize employee assignments in terms of minimumoperational time in completing work using the Hungarian method.From the results of research using the Hungarian method, timeefficiency is obtained as much as 8 hours if employees in deliveringgoods on the NugrahaEkakurir (JNE) route are placed by the company,namely Ferdi assigned to Medan Tuntungan, Ichsan assigned to MedanSelayang, Riki was assigned to Medan Amplas, Fitriadi assigned toMedan Johor, Irvan was assigned to Delitua, Suryadi was assigned toPatumbak, Edward was assigned to PancurBatu, Citradi was assigned toKutalimbaru, Audi was assigned to Medan Baru and Widiyanto wasassigned to Sunggal.

Abstract

The existence of shortages and excesses of production raw materials often occurs in the NR Brownies company where this situation greatly influences the smooth production process, especially in the supply of raw materials which results in sub-optimal expenditure costs. The aim of this research is to find solution how to prevent companies from experiencing these problems on a regular basis which results in less than optimal spending costs. In overcoming this problem, the Material Requirement Planning method is applied, this method is expected to minimize expenditure costs so that the benefits obtained are more optimal. From the research results, the Material Requirement Planning Method for EOQ calculations produces the minimum costs for sugar and oil raw materials of 18.295.130 and 19.591.230 respectively, while the POQ calculation produces the minimum costs for raw materials 14.839.500 for flour, 15.450.000 for eggs, 1.356.650 for cocoa flour, and 2.504.387 for baking powder.

Abstract

VRP distributions have had difficulty overcoming the problem of finding channels with minimal depots to locations that have different places with different total demand. The purpose of this study is to analyze the problem of transportation routes in the distribution of products obtained from the initial location of distribution to users. This type of research is qualitative research. This research was conducted at PT. Nusa Persada Concrete Creations. The Nearest Neighbor method is used to determine the distribution of routes. The Local Search method is carried out to evaluate and improve the distribution of routes carried out at the beginning with the Nearest Neighbors method. The data analysis process consists of several stages with the Nearest Neighbor method and the LocalSearch method.
